3. ( /16 pts) When considering solutions to the Schrodinger equation there are two possible types of solutions; bound states and scattering states. (a) (4 pts) Compare and contrast these two types of solutions, specifically addressing the following characteristics . allowed values of total energy E . normalizabelity (b) (12 pts) Consider the potential shown as the solid line in the figure below. Each dotted line corresponds to a possible energy for a particle. Identify each as bound or scattering and explain your reasoning. State whether you expect the energy will be quantized, continuous, or both, and explain your reasoning
